The first thing you have to decide, is whether you are going to use your personal name or an assumed name. Some authors use a number of names because they write about a variety of subjects and if they used their own name for every subject, they would perhaps not appear that credible. We certainly want the reader to believe that we are an expert on the subject we are writing about….and we might very well be, but the reader might not be convinced if they see our name attached to so many articles on many different subjects.
Obviously, if you are trying to brand yourself on the Internet, then you would want to use your personal name as much as possible. If the subject matter can be in some way related to the type of business you are in, then it is going to be much easier to transition with a link back to your website.
It is recommended that articles be between 400 – 600 words. That works out to be about 8 paragraphs, with approximately three short sentences in each paragraph. If it much better to write a few short articles, than one long one.

You might be wondering how I was able to accomplish this. O.K. I’ll tell you!! All it took was for me to write 10 short articles and have them accepted by EzineArticles. This is the largest article directory and should be the first place that you submit your articles to. This is the litmus test….if EzineArticles approves it, then rest assured it will be accepted at all other directories.
However, just getting published with EzineArticles is not going to get you the huge presence on the Internet that you are looking for. There is an important second step to take and that is to sent it off to a multiple submission company. The one I use, and which I highly recommend, is Unique Article Wizard (UAW). On their website, you type in three unique versions of your article, along with variations in the Resource Box. UAW then configures all the paragraphs and resource boxes and comes up with hundreds and hundreds of unique articles. This is very important, because the search engines do not like duplication and you will not be rewarded at all for it….in fact, they could punish you. One of my articles was submitted to over 1800 directories by UAW.
There is no cost to getting started with Ezine Articles. However, there is a $70.35 a month cost for UAW. If you are only planning on writing an article now and again, then obviously it would not be worth your while to join them. However, if you are serious about creating a huge presence on the Internet and generating free leads through your articles, then this is definitely a great way to go.
